154
submitted 1 day ago* (last edited 1 day ago) by Ephera@lemmy.ml to c/linuxmemes@lemmy.world

The theme comes in three variants, "Soft Light", "Medium Light" and "Hard Light". Soft and Medium are even yellower. This is so often the case with Gruvbox themes. I just want a white background, is that so unusual? ๐Ÿซ 

(Yes, that's a screenshot of my terminal with the theme applied. Yes, I am one of those monsters that use a terminal with light theme.)

top 15 comments
sorted by: hot top new old
[-] JayDee@lemmy.sdf.org 15 points 1 day ago

You're transgression has been noted. The gruvbox police will be over to collect four shortly for light theme crimes. /j

I'll be honest I don't even know vhat gruvbox is.

[-] Ephera@lemmy.ml 4 points 1 day ago

As far as I'm aware, it started out with a Vim color scheme, which looks like this:


https://github.com/morhetz/gruvbox

And yeah, that's just become a really popular theme, which got ported to virtually anything that can be themed.
Personally, I really like the color palette, but not that so many takes on it have text that's horrendously difficult to read...

[-] Botzo@lemmy.world 5 points 1 day ago

"Hard" (high contrast) should use the bg0_h value for the background: #f9f5d7 or rgb(249,245,215).

This is a light "off white". If you have blue blocking mode or a night color mode enabled, the yellowing effect will be exaggerated.

For what is worth, I don't think gruvbox makes a good light theme because it's pretty low contrast especially compared to a lot of more recent themes. I say this as a die hard gruvbox dark user.

[-] Ephera@lemmy.ml 4 points 1 day ago

I guess, what really bothers me here in particular is the extra low contrast. The background does actually use the correct color, that you point out. But the foreground/text color is #654735. That's brown:

Screenshot of a color picker, where the color is visible as brown. It's almost halfway in terms brightness and saturation towards an orange.

I don't know where that color comes from. None of the original Gruvbox colors are that. It is dubbed as a "Gruvbox Material" theme. I do have opinions about the new Material You styles having shit contrast. But I don't believe, it's supposed to be quite as terrible either.

And well, yeah, I do usually end up modifying the Gruvbox themes to just set background to #ffffff, foreground to #000000, or vice versa for dark themes. It does work quite well IMHO, which is what makes it all the more frustrating that so many Gruvbox-like themes choose to go the other way.

[-] Botzo@lemmy.world 2 points 22 hours ago* (last edited 22 hours ago)

Material themes definitely tend to be softer. I hate them as a rule.

Gruvbox material fg0 definition

Edit:

Surprisingly, this passes a basic accessibility check. https://webaim.org/resources/contrastchecker/?fcolor=654735&bcolor=F9F5D7

[-] Ephera@lemmy.ml 3 points 21 hours ago* (last edited 21 hours ago)

Oh man, you keep finding these hex values in other places. I assumed the author of this particular theme just made them up, based on what they thought looked good.

And yeah, that is wild to me, that it passes a contrast check. I'm far from having the worst eyesight and still find it needlessly difficult to read.

[-] juipeltje@lemmy.world 2 points 23 hours ago

Gruvbox is probably my favorite theme. I configured a handfull of themes for my rice but gruvbox and tokyonight are the ones i use the most. I'm a dark user though >:)

[-] serpineslair@lemmy.world 6 points 1 day ago

I use my own theme gruvbox_super_dark.... Literally Gruvbox Hard Dark, with a fully #000000 background.

[-] Ephera@lemmy.ml 4 points 1 day ago

Yeah, I do customize the themes like that, too, usually also #ffffff for the foreground or vice versa. It would just be nice to not need to maintain my own themes. ๐Ÿฅด

[-] serpineslair@lemmy.world 3 points 1 day ago

Yeah it'd be nice if Gruvbox shipped with those as options.

[-] prole@lemmy.blahaj.zone 3 points 1 day ago

Do people still use light themes? Wild.

[-] Markuso213@piefed.social 10 points 1 day ago

For bright situations, 100%.

Like working on a sunny balcony is far more comfortable with a light theme than a dark theme. Perhaps with a really good AMOLED screen I could still vibe with the dark, but in general I'd go light with (particularly) bright surroundings.

[-] Ephera@lemmy.ml 1 points 1 day ago

I try to kick my circadian rhythm with ample light, so for that I switch between light and dark theme more or less around sunrise/sunset. Staring into a bright screen with light theme isn't as bright as being outside, but then I can at least also turn on all kinds of lights or sit outside somewhere, without it being as detrimental to readability as it would be with a dark theme.

[-] UNY0N@feddit.org 2 points 1 day ago

You should try this out. I haven't tried it myself, but I've been meaning to.

https://github.com/luisbocanegra/kde-material-you-colors

this post was submitted on 03 Apr 2026
154 points (97.0% liked)

linuxmemes

30895 readers
380 users here now

Hint: :q!


Sister communities:


Community rules (click to expand)

1. Follow the site-wide rules

2. Be civil
  • Understand the difference between a joke and an insult.
  • Do not harrass or attack users for any reason. This includes using blanket terms, like "every user of thing".
  • Don't get baited into back-and-forth insults. We are not animals.
  • Leave remarks of "peasantry" to the PCMR community. If you dislike an OS/service/application, attack the thing you dislike, not the individuals who use it. Some people may not have a choice.
  • Bigotry will not be tolerated.
  • 3. Post Linux-related content
  • Including Unix and BSD.
  • Non-Linux content is acceptable as long as it makes a reference to Linux. For example, the poorly made mockery of sudo in Windows.
  • No porn, no politics, no trolling or ragebaiting.
  • Don't come looking for advice, this is not the right community.
  • 4. No recent reposts
  • Everybody uses Arch btw, can't quit Vim, <loves/tolerates/hates> systemd, and wants to interject for a moment. You can stop now.
  • 5. ๐Ÿ‡ฌ๐Ÿ‡ง Language/ัะทั‹ะบ/Sprache
  • This is primarily an English-speaking community. ๐Ÿ‡ฌ๐Ÿ‡ง๐Ÿ‡ฆ๐Ÿ‡บ๐Ÿ‡บ๐Ÿ‡ธ
  • Comments written in other languages are allowed.
  • The substance of a post should be comprehensible for people who only speak English.
  • Titles and post bodies written in other languages will be allowed, but only as long as the above rule is observed.
  • 6. (NEW!) Regarding public figuresWe all have our opinions, and certain public figures can be divisive. Keep in mind that this is a community for memes and light-hearted fun, not for airing grievances or leveling accusations.
  • Keep discussions polite and free of disparagement.
  • We are never in possession of all of the facts. Defamatory comments will not be tolerated.
  • Discussions that get too heated will be locked and offending comments removed.
  • ย 

    Please report posts and comments that break these rules!


    Important: never execute code or follow advice that you don't understand or can't verify, especially here. The word of the day is credibility. This is a meme community -- even the most helpful comments might just be shitposts that can damage your system. Be aware, be smart, don't remove France.

    founded 2 years ago
    MODERATORS